要知道,服务器是用来提供各类服务(如:Web服务、FTP服务、视频直播等)的计算机,其本质上只是更专业化的计算机,服务器要想提供这些服务是需要进行许多配置的。对于单台服务器,你可能有时间和精力慢慢配置服务器环境,但对于有很多台服务器都要进行配置,这个工作量就很大了,那有没有办法能快速搭建服务器环境呢?
创新互联建站长期为1000+客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为望奎企业提供专业的成都网站制作、做网站,望奎网站改版等技术服务。拥有十余年丰富建站经验和众多成功案例,为您定制开发。
答案是有的,无论是服务器的系统环境还是软件运行环境都是有成熟方案来实现快速部署的。
通过虚拟化技术快速搭建服务器操作系统环境
当前流行的服务器操作系统主要有两大类:Windows Server、Linux类,正常情况下如果想安装一个操作系统是比较耗时的,一般在半小时左右,这样部署服务器环境效率过低。不过好在有虚拟化技术来实现操作系统的快速实例化,这样只要基于已存在的境像快速克隆一个完整的操作系统出来。
常见的虚拟化方案有:Docker、VMware、VirtualBox等,可以把虚拟化技术理解成以前装机用的Ghost系统。
通过集成安装包来部署软件环境
服务器系统安装好之后,还要安装一些服务器端软件,比如WEB服务器就要安装:WEB容器(如Nginx、Tomcat)、数据库(如MySQL、SQL Server)等。服务器端软件环境往往要安装很多种不同的软件,此时可以靠一些集成环境安装包来一键式安装。
比如想搭建PHP网站运行环境就有WAMP、LAMP一键安装包,或者我们借助Docker也能实现。
1. 开通一台适合的云服务器
2. 服务器上配置安装docker
3. 下载你所需要的服务运行环境的docker镜像到开发机器
4. 使用开发工具制作相应的docker镜像
5. 将镜像推送到远端服务器docker里面
6. 在服务端配置相应的网络
Over
由于题主没有明确是哪种环境,下面主要介绍两大系统平台的运行环境的最简部署方式。
1. Linux系统 - 宝塔面板
2. Windows - 宝塔面板、PhpStudy(比较简单)
初学者、怕麻烦的程序猿或者运维工程师都会使用一类综合的环境部署工具,例如宝塔面板来构建程序的基础环境,善于探索和不怕麻烦的程序猿、运维老鸟都可能会独立部署服务器运行环境。
注:由于Linux生态多种多要,但是安装方式大同小异,因包管理器和构建工具的不同,稍稍有点差异,但是在安装宝塔面板上,没有区别。
宝塔Linux面板是提升运维效率的服务器管理软件,支持一键LAMP/LNMP/集群/监控/网站/FTP/数据库/JAVA等100多项服务器管理功能。
有20个人的专业团队研发及维护,经过200多个版本的迭代,功能全,少出错且足够安全,已获得全球百万用户认可安装。运维要高效,装宝塔。
服务器服务种类这么多,你问的是哪个种服务呢?我举例最广泛的网页服务器吧,国外的用了很久的xampp,wamp,国内的宝塔,phpstudy,qampp,phpenv,等等。基础的先学windows下的吧,linux下的稍复杂些
到此,以上就是小编对于web服务器怎么安装与配置软件的问题就介绍到这了,希望这1点解答对大家有用。
当前名称:服务器运行环境怎么快速搭建?(web服务器怎么安装与配置)
文章出自:http://www.shufengxianlan.com/qtweb/news22/269972.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联